Understanding Your Skin Type and Prep

The foundation of any flawless makeup look starts with understanding your skin. Is it oily, dry, combination, or sensitive? Each skin type requires a different approach to preparation. For oily skin, a lightweight, oil-free moisturizer and a mattifying primer are essential. Dry skin, on the other hand, needs rich hydration with a hydrating serum and a moisturizing primer. Combination skin benefits from targeted treatment, using mattifying products on oily areas and hydrating products on dry areas. Sensitive skin requires gentle, fragrance-free products to avoid irritation. Proper cleansing is crucial; use a gentle cleanser suited to your skin type to remove impurities without stripping the skin’s natural oils. Exfoliating 1-2 times a week helps remove dead skin cells, creating a smooth canvas for makeup application. Remember, well-prepped skin is the key to a smooth and long-lasting makeup finish.

Choosing the Right Foundation and Application Techniques

Selecting the right foundation is paramount for achieving a flawless finish. Consider your skin type, coverage needs, and desired finish. Liquid foundations are versatile and suitable for most skin types, while powder foundations are great for oily skin. Cream foundations offer buildable coverage and a dewy finish, ideal for dry skin. When choosing a shade, test it in natural light to ensure it matches your skin tone perfectly. Application techniques vary depending on the desired coverage and finish. For light coverage, use a damp beauty sponge to stipple the foundation onto the skin. For medium coverage, use a foundation brush to buff the product into the skin in circular motions. For full coverage, use a dense brush or sponge to build up the product in layers. Remember to blend, blend, blend! A seamless blend is crucial for a natural-looking finish.

Concealing Imperfections Like a Pro

Concealer is your best friend when it comes to hiding blemishes, dark circles, and uneven skin tone. Choose a concealer that is one to two shades lighter than your foundation for brightening the under-eye area. For blemishes, opt for a concealer that matches your skin tone to avoid drawing attention to the area. Apply concealer in thin layers, focusing on the areas that need the most coverage. Use a small, pointed brush for precise application on blemishes and a larger, fluffy brush or sponge for blending under the eyes. Set your concealer with a light dusting of translucent powder to prevent creasing and ensure long-lasting wear. Remember, less is more when it comes to concealer. Avoid applying too much product, as it can look cakey and unnatural.

Mastering the Art of Contouring and Highlighting

Contouring and highlighting are essential techniques for sculpting and defining your features. Contouring creates shadows to add depth and dimension, while highlighting enhances the high points of your face. Choose a contour shade that is two to three shades darker than your skin tone and has a cool undertone to mimic natural shadows. Apply contour along the hollows of your cheeks, temples, jawline, and sides of your nose to create definition. Use a highlighting shade that is one to two shades lighter than your skin tone and has a shimmer or satin finish to catch the light. Apply highlighter to the high points of your cheeks, brow bone, inner corner of your eyes, and cupid’s bow to add radiance. Blend both contour and highlighter seamlessly for a natural-looking finish. Remember, the goal is to enhance your features, not to create harsh lines.

The Importance of Setting Your Makeup

Setting your makeup is crucial for ensuring long-lasting wear and preventing creasing and fading. Use a translucent setting powder to set your foundation and concealer, focusing on areas that tend to get oily, such as the T-zone. Apply the powder with a large, fluffy brush or a beauty sponge, pressing it gently into the skin. For extra hold, try baking your makeup by applying a generous amount of powder to the under-eye area and letting it sit for 5-10 minutes before dusting it off. Finish with a setting spray to lock everything in place and create a seamless finish. Choose a setting spray that is suitable for your skin type – mattifying for oily skin, hydrating for dry skin, and balancing for combination skin. Remember, setting your makeup is the key to a flawless, long-lasting look that will stay put all day.

Finishing Touches for a Polished Look

Once your base makeup is complete, it’s time to add the finishing touches that will elevate your look to the next level. Define your brows with a brow pencil or powder, filling in any sparse areas and creating a defined shape. Apply eyeshadow to enhance your eyes, choosing colors that complement your skin tone and eye color. Line your eyes with eyeliner to add definition and create a more dramatic look. Curl your lashes and apply mascara to add volume and length. Finish with a lip color that complements your overall look, whether it’s a nude lipstick for a natural finish or a bold red for a statement look. Remember, the finishing touches are what tie everything together and create a polished, cohesive look.
